Understanding the US Presidential Election Process
Alright, let's get down to the basics, shall we? The United States Presidential Election is a complex process, but understanding how it works is key to making sense of the results as they roll in. The election happens every four years, and it's basically a two-stage process. First, we have the primaries and caucuses. These are where the political parties choose their nominees. Think of it like a preliminary round, with each party narrowing down the field of potential candidates. Then, the main event: the general election. This is when the chosen nominees from the Democratic and Republican parties (and any other significant third-party candidates) face off, and we, the voters, get to cast our ballots. But wait, there's more! It's not as simple as just counting up the votes. The U.S. uses the Electoral College. Each state gets a certain number of electors based on its population. When you vote for a presidential candidate, you're actually voting for these electors, who then cast the official votes for president. Generally, the candidate who wins the popular vote in a state gets all of that state's electoral votes. The candidate who gets more than half of the 538 electoral votes (270) wins the presidency. The Role of Primaries and Caucuses
Before the main event, the primaries and caucuses are where the parties select their candidates. It's a crucial part of the process, and it works differently depending on the party and the state. Primaries are basically state-run elections where voters cast ballots for their preferred candidate. Caucuses, on the other hand, are meetings where party members gather to discuss and show their support for a candidate. These are often more involved and can take place over several hours. The results of the primaries and caucuses determine which candidates will go on to compete in the general election. The early primaries and caucuses, like those in Iowa and New Hampshire, are especially important because they can help build momentum for a candidate and shape the race. They can also narrow the field, as candidates who don't perform well often drop out. So, as you follow the election, keep an eye on these early contests. They often set the tone for the rest of the campaign season. These early contests can reveal which candidates have the strongest support and which messages resonate with voters. What to Watch for on Election Night
Election night is a long night, so here's what to watch for: keep an eye on the early vote counts, particularly in states with high numbers of early voters. This could give us an early indication of the overall trends. Then, watch the key swing states. These will be the ones that determine who wins the election. Pay attention to the turnout. High turnout can often favor one party over another. Watch the key demographics. If one party does much better than others among specific demographics, it could swing the election. Keep an eye on the electoral vote count, as it shows the evolving map of the election results. Remember, the winner needs 270 electoral votes to win. Finally, watch the speeches. Both winning and losing candidates often give speeches. Be sure to pay attention to them. Watch for the tone and content of their message, as they may hint at future actions.
